Pradhan Mantri Matsya Sampada Yojana (PMMSY): ₹31.21 Crore Integrated Aqua Park

Key facts

  • Union Minister for Fisheries, Animal Husbandry & Dairying and Panchayati Raj Rajiv Ranjan Singh and Chief Minister of Bihar Samrat Choudhary will lay the foundation stone of the Integrated Aqua Park at Bhojpur and inaugurate the National Fisheries Development Board (NFDB) Regional Centre at Patna on 15 June 2026.
  • The Integrated Aqua Park at Vanasaur Fish Seed Farm, Bhojpur, is approved at a total cost of ₹31.21 crore under the Pradhan Mantri Matsya Sampada Yojana (PMMSY).
  • The Aqua Park will include carp and catfish hatcheries, brooder incubation units, biofloc systems, Recirculating Aquaculture System (RAS) units, a fish feed mill, water quality and disease diagnostic laboratories, quarantine facilities, and a 50-bed training hostel.
  • Bihar's inland water resources consist of 1.22 lakh ha of tanks and ponds, 0.64 lakh ha of reservoirs, 9.5 lakh ha of floodplain lakes (chaurs) and derelict waters, and over 21,354 km of rivers and canals.
  • Principal fish species cultured in Bihar include Catla, Rohu, Mrigal, Grass Carp, Common Carp, Silver Carp, Pabda, Tilapia, Pangasius, Magur (catfish), Scampi, and ornamental fish.
  • The Government of India has approved projects worth ₹902.84 crore for Bihar over the last 11 years, including ₹579.72 crore under PMMSY.
  • Bihar has risen from 9th to 4th position among inland fish-producing States and supplies approximately 89,600 MT of fish annually to neighbouring States.
  • A Wetland Fisheries Cluster covering 9.5 lakh ha of floodplain lakes and derelict water bodies has been notified in Bihar to promote community-based fisheries management.
  • The Government of India is promoting integrated development through PMMSY, Fisheries Infrastructure Development Fund (FIDF), and Pradhan Mantri Matsya Kisan Samridhi Yojana (PM-MKSSY).
